Pendle Council issues warning over council tax benefit

Pendle Council is warning residents that council tax benefit will change from April 1.

Council tax support will replace the current benefit and working-age claimants are likely to receive less support than they did before.

Coun Linda Crossley, lead member on council finances, said: “The Government has made these changes to encourage people back into work. But pensioners will be protected from any reduction in financial support.

“We’re aware that this could be a big change for some people so we’re encouraging them to find out what it might mean and, where necessary, start making arrangements to pay their council tax.”

It is likely claimants will have to pay something towards their bills.
